Manji is not an unfamiliar face in the entertainment industry. His acting career includes numerous roles in TV shows such as Without a Trace, American Desi and 24. In the critically acclaimed movie Charlie Wilson’s War, Manji played the part of Colonel Mahmood. The film ranked fourth at the box office.
Though it is challenging at times to be an actor of colour in the West, Manji feels fortunate that the door of opportunity for South Asian actors is finally opening.
“It is still a struggle but there are more South Asian actors showing up in sitcoms, dramas and films,” Manji states
